Whether you work at a factory or in an office, you could be at risk for injury or illness on the job. Workplace injury accidents often result in not only expensive medical bills, but significant lost income and earning potential due to any disabilities or inabilities to continue working. If your employer has workers compensation insurance, you may file a claim with them to help offset your medical expenses and loss of income. The state of Texas does NOT require employers to carry workers compensation insurance. If your employer does not carry workers compensation insurance, you may be entitled to take legal action against your employer or a responsible third party to seek fair compensation after you are injured on the job.
There Are Many Unsafe Conditions That Can Cause A Workplace Injury
- Lack of safety training
- Improper lighting
- Failure to provide safety gear
- Toxic substances
- OSHA violations
- Overexertion in lifting
- Improperly maintained machines
- Tripping hazards
- Locked/blocked exits.
If you are injured at work, notify your employer of the injury as soon as possible and report the injury in writing. Always keep a copy of the report for your records and for your attorney to review. Immediately reporting the injury will help your claim in the long run.
